New stills from The Lord of the Rings: The Power of the Rings series show the significance of including people of color

Recently, new stills from the series "The Lord of the Rings: The Power of the Rings" were released, showing the Hobbits, including Sadoc Burrows, played by Lenny Henry.

Henry said that the little people in Middle-earth can bring comic effects and show incredible courage, and the audience will see their adventures in the series. Henry also said that it is meaningful to add people of color to Middle-earth to make Middle-earth diverse. People of color will have a place in this fantasy drama, which will make children and audiences very excited.

Producer Payne said that Amazon bought all five seasons of The Lord of the Rings: The Power of the Rings in one go, and had planned them long ago. These five seasons have a beginning, an end, and a process, and even the finale scene has been designed. Some content in the first season will not be echoed until the fifth season, so the audience does not have to worry about the series being temporarily changed.

Payne also said that although the "Lord of the Rings: The Power of the Rings" series does not tell the story created by Tolkien himself, he believes that it fits in with Tolkien's imagination of the wider Middle-earth world. He said: "Tolkien wanted to leave a myth to leave room for other people's ideas and creations. We are doing what Tolkien wanted, and as long as our creation fits in with the core of Tolkien's story, it must be the right path."

The first season of The Lord of the Rings: The Power of the Rings will premiere on September 2, with a total of 8 episodes. It is reported that the first season cost $465 million, making it the most expensive TV series ever, and this is only one season.
